Pune warriors was terminated in the 2014 season, and the IPL was down to eight teams. Shikhar Dhawan and Darren Sammy were handed reigns to Sunrisers Hyderabad as Captain and deputy. The dates of the tournament clashed with the Lok Sabha Elections in India, which resulted in the initial phase of the IPL playing out in the UAE. Sunrisers Hyderabad had an ordinary season, languishing at the bottom of the table. Indian Premier League 2015 schedule: IPL 8 match time table with venue details

The Sunrisers Hyderabad also had a good time in the auctions as they finished with 10 more players in their bag, with New Zealand’s Trent Boult being the top buy for Rs. 3.80 crore, along with Praveen Kumar (Rs. 2.20 crore), Kevin Pietersen of England (Rs. 2 crore), Eoin Morgan of England (Rs. 1.50 crore), Ravi Bopara of England (Rs. 1 crore), Kane Williamson of New Zealand (Rs. 60 lakhs), Laxmi Ratan Shukla (Rs. 30 lakhs). Following are the players bought by Sunrisers Hyderabad (SRH) in IPL 2015 Auction:

Players

Base Price

Selling Price

Playing Role

Country

Kane Williamson Rs. 50,00,000 Rs. 60,00,000 All-rounder New Zealand
Eoin Morgan Rs. 1,50,00,000 Rs. 1,50,00,000 Batsman England
Kevin Pietersen Rs. 2,00,00,000 Rs. 2,00,00,000 Batsman England
Ravi Bopara Rs. 1,00,00,000 Rs. 1,00,00,000 All-rounder England
Laxmi Ratan Shukla Rs. 30,00,000 Rs. 30,00,000 All-rounder India
Praveen Kumar Rs. 50,00,000 Rs. 2,20,00,000 Bowler India
Trent Boult Rs. 50,00,000 Rs. 3,80,00,000 Bowler New Zealand
Hanuma Vihari Rs. 10,00,000 Rs. 10,00,000 Batsman India
P Padmanabhan Rs. 10,00,000 Rs. 10,00,000 Batsman India
Siddharth Kaul Rs 10,00,000 Rs. 10,00,000 Bowler India

Players retained by Sunrisers Hyderabad (SRH) for IPL 8

 

Name Role Country
Shikhar Dhawan Batsman India
Bhuvneshwar Kumar Bowler India
Dale Steyn Bowler South Africa
David Warner Batsman Australia
Ishant Sharma Bowler India
Karn Sharma Bowler India
KL Rahul Batsman India
Moises Henriques All-rounder Australia
Naman Ojha Batsman India
Parveez Rasool Bowler India

The 2015 IPL auction is all set to take place in Bangalore on Monday for the upcoming season this year, which will be the eighth edition of the cash-rich league. Around 200 players are expected to go through the auctions with the eight franchises to battle it out with their funds. Delhi Daredevils will be the team to watch out for as they have released most of their players and look to rebuild their team in wake of the dismal performance last season, thus finishing at the bottom of the table.
